 Mumbai, 3rd December, 2025: Kapadia Hospital has completed over 100 surgeries in just eight months, becoming the first in Mumbai to implement a state-of-the-art robotic system for AI-enabled, robotic-activated knee replacements. This Made-in-India innovation marks a significant milestone in advancing accessible and affordable domestic medical technologies.

 This new system uses specialized software that can take into account real-time data to build an accurate 3D model of each individual patient’s anatomy. This allows surgeons to perform extremely precise cuts of bone, as well as to place implants in the proper position. The MISSO robotic system is also equipped with an optical camera for tracking, safety mechanisms, and the ability to make intraoperative adjustments that improve joint stability and facilitate easier movement after surgical completion using an advanced six-joint robotic arm.

MISSO integrates robotic planning and execution using AI technology, so it can offer a streamlined system for robotic replacement of joints by incorporating advanced surgical technology, including the 6-axis robotic arm, robotic-guidance systems, and any additional safety features required for performing a robotic procedure on a patient.

 Additionally, the advantages of using MISSO include more precise alignment of the bones, improved healing from less traumatic injury to surrounding tissues, less bleeding during surgery, less post-surgical recovery period, faster return to full mobility, and a greater likelihood that the patient will be able to afford and access robotic replacement surgery. By using a system designed and manufactured in India, Kapadia Hospital is providing patients with world-class, robotic-assisted knee replacement technology at an affordable price.

 According to Dr. Rahul Modi, Orthopedic Surgeon, Kapadia Hospital, said, "MISSO is a significant advancement in orthopaedic care in India, allowing for greater availability of advanced surgeries for many people due to the increased precision, safety and efficiency of MISSO. We are excited to bring Mumbai's first AI-Based Robotic Knee Replacement System to the region."

 The MISSO design includes built-in safety features, including real-time tracking and automatic correction capabilities designed to significantly reduce any possibility of making intraoperative mistakes.
